Spanish - Amherst

Enrolling in a Spanish speaking drug rehab program is no different than their English speaking counterparts. In fact, a vast majority of Spanish speaking drug treatment programs also speak English some of the time as well. The staff members are typically bilingual and able to communicate effortlessly in either language. A drug rehab that presents Spanish as a language option will provide their clients with all counseling (and other forms of communication), questionnaires, paperwork and educational info in both languages as required. These specialized drug treatment centers work with people from all socio-economic backgrounds who are dedicated to addressing their drug addiction problem. The staff at these treatment centers is generally well versed on domestic violence, aftercare counseling and job development to aid their specialized client group.
